Analysis
In 2024, annual share of co2 emissions in Bonaire, Sint Eustatius and Saba stood at 0.0004.
The figure is up 2.5% on the previous year and up 19.0% over ten years.
Over the whole period, annual share of co2 emissions in Bonaire, Sint Eustatius and Saba peaked at 0.0036 in 1954 and was at its lowest, 0, in 1926.
That places Bonaire, Sint Eustatius and Saba 200th out of 210 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the bottom qu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
